Understanding Door Handle Fixing Costs: A Comprehensive Guide

When a door handle breaks or breakdowns, it can disrupt the functionality and security of an office or home. Whether handling a door handle that will not turn, is loose, or has actually totally fallen off, comprehending the expenses connected with fixing it is essential. In this blog post, we will dig into the factors that affect door handle fixing costs, provide a breakdown of different circumstances, and address some regularly asked concerns.

Aspects Influencing Door Handle Fixing Costs

  1. Type of Door Handle: Specific types of door handles (lever, knob, electronic, etc) will affect expenses.
  2. Material: The material of the door handle (plastic, metal, bronze) can impact both the rate of replacement parts and labor expenses.
  3. Labor Charges: Local labor rates can vary significantly based on geographical area and the experience of the handyman or locksmith.
  4. Complexity of the Repair: Some repairs may need more time and knowledge, causing increased labor costs.
  5. Service Warranty or Service Contracts: If the door handle is under guarantee or if you have a service contract, expenses might be mitigated.

Table 1: Average Repair Costs for Different Types of Door Handles

Type of Door HandleTypical Repair Cost (₤)Replacement Cost (₤)Notes
Requirement Knob Handle50 - 15015 - 40Typically found in residential doors.
Lever Handle70 - 20020 - 60More modern and ergonomic style.
Electronic Handle100 - 30050 - 150Needs specialized installation.
Patio Door Handle60 - 18025 - 60Typically includes moving systems.
French Door Handle90 - 25030 - 80May need professional installation.
Industrial Handle120 - 40040 - 100Designed for heavy usage; frequently code-compliant.

Breakdown of Door Handle Fixing Scenarios

1. Simple Repair

This scenario usually involves tightening screws or straightening a loose handle. A basic repair can normally be done in under an hour, frequently without the need for replacement parts.

2. Replacement of Handle

If the handle is broken or considerably worn, changing it may be needed. The costs will depend on the kind of handle selected, from spending plan designs to high-end electronic choices.

3. Complex Repair

In cases where internal systems or the entire door lock system is harmed, a more complicated repair or complete replacement may be needed.

FAQ: Door Handle Fixing Costs

Q1: How do I know if I require to change my door handle?

A: If the handle is noticeably harmed, wobbly, or does not engage the latch correctly, it might be time to change it.

Q2: Can I fix a door handle myself?

A: Yes, many minor problems such as tightening up screws or changing knobs can be managed by a DIY lover with basic tools. However, complicated repairs must be delegated specialists.

Q3: What is the average lifespan of a door handle?

A: The average life expectancy of a basic door handle is in between 5 to 10 years, depending upon use and maintenance.

Q4: Are electronic door handles worth the investment?

A: Electronic door handles can provide convenience and included security. Nevertheless, they can be more pricey to fix or change.

Q5: How can I find a dependable handyman or locksmith?

A: Check online reviews, request recommendations from good friends or family, and make sure the professional is accredited and insured.
